Question

I entered my medical expenses, and claimed them on this tax return. I have surpassed the minimum threshold amount, and yet my taxable income is unchanged. Why?

    Medical expenses are not deducted until Line 33099, so Line 26000 Taxable income is not changed when you add medical expenses.

    Ok thank you. I think I asked my question incorrectly, because what I'm really trying to understand is why do I still owe the exact same amount of money on my return? I entered over $1k of expenses.

    TurboTaxAniqua
    April 23, 2025

    Are the medical expenses 3% of your net income (line 23600) or $2,759 (for tax year 2024)?
